Output 09312f41a075f65caf50ca240309ed9d94aafed1e4f016789d02efe2de531081:1

value
35073804
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 efb103c0e960e4378fb261d42934773b8ac677ba OP_EQUALVERIFY OP_CHECKSIG
address
Lh5KpFjYY36X7aAMSR5t5yUXQEWSWkLoaK
transaction
09312f41a075f65caf50ca240309ed9d94aafed1e4f016789d02efe2de531081
spent
true